WebApr 10, 2000 · Download PDF Abstract: We introduce an extension of the \ell-reduced KP hierarchy, which we call the \ell-Bogoyavlensky hierarchy. Bogoyavlensky's 2+1-dimensional extension of the KdV equation is the lowest equation of the hierarchy in case of \ell=2. Web[en] In this paper, we obtain shock wave solutions to Bogoyavlensky-Konoplechenko equation, which is a two-dimensional generalization of the well known Korteweg-de Vries equation. Ansatz approach is utilized to carry out this integration.
